<html><head><meta name="color-scheme" content="light dark"></head><body><pre style="word-wrap: break-word; white-space: pre-wrap;">@media (max-width:1200px){
.project-name h2{font-size:34px}
.vertical-heading{font-size:40px;right:110px;
    -webkit-transform:rotate(-90deg) translateX(50%);
    -moz-transform:rotate(-90deg) translateX(50%);
    -ms-transform:rotate(-90deg) translateX(50%);
    -o-transform:rotate(-90deg) translateX(50%);
    transform:rotate(-90deg) translateX(50%);
}
.featured-carousel-wrap{padding-right:200px}
.big-text{font-size:45px}
.innovative-img img.short-img{margin-right:-230px}
.classic-services-wrapp img{width:550px}
.video-text h3{font-size:32px}
.process-inner h3{font-size:17px}
.big-desc{font-size:20px}
.octa-address strong{font-size:30px}
.octa-address i{font-size:20px}
.big-intro{font-size:60px}
.huge-text i{font-size:300px}
.mod-feat-text h1{font-size:40px}
.mod-feat-text{padding-right:100px}
.contact-box{padding:50px 20px}
.portfolio-single-img.stretch{width:100%;margin-left:0}
.octa-fullpage-title{margin-left:70px}
.feature-text h3{font-size:30px}


.innovative-intro h1{font-size:45px}
.innovative-intro h1 strong{font-size:45px}
}

@media (max-width:980px){
nav{display:none}
nav ~ a.menu-btn{display:block}
.simple-featured h2{font-size:80px}
section .row &gt; div,
section .row &gt; aside{float:left;width:100%;display:unset;flex:none;max-width:none}
section .container &gt; .row &gt; div,
section .block &gt; .row &gt; div{margin:0 0 60px}
section .container &gt; .row &gt; div:last-child,
section .block &gt; .row &gt; div:last-child{margin:0}
.big-title{font-size:130px;margin:0 0 -13px}
.masonary &gt; div{width:50%;float:left;max-width:none}
.octa-counters .row &gt; div{width:50%}
.octa-team .row &gt; div{float:left;width:50%}
.project-name{display:unset;float:left;width:100%;padding:40px !important}
.project-video{display:unset;float:left;width:100%;
    -webkit-transform:translate(0);
    -moz-transform:translate(0);
    -ms-transform:translate(0);
    -o-transform:translate(0);
    transform:translate(0);
}
.octa-blog .masonary &gt; div{width:100%}
.octa-contacts-opts{text-align:center}
.octa-contacts-opts .row &gt; div{float:none;display:inline-block;width:50%;margin:0 -2px}
.octa-contacts-opts .row{display:unset} 
.contact-opts i{display:block;width:100%;margin:0 0 15px}
.opt-detail{display:unset;width:100%;text-align:center}
.opt-detail strong{width:100%} 
.contact-opts{padding:0;width:100%}
.vertical-heading{position:relative;transform:none;right:auto;left:auto;top:auto;width:100%;float:left;width:100%;text-align:center;padding:0 20px;margin-top:30px}
.featured-carousel-wrap{padding:0}
.feature-text{padding:60px 15px}
.feature-text h3{font-size:25px}
.mockup.style2{margin:-300px 0 0}
footer .container &gt; .row &gt; div{max-width:50%;margin:0 0 60px;display:unset;flex:none}
.classic-services-wrapp img{display:unset;width:100%;margin:0 0 80px}
.classic-services-wrapp{display:unset}
.classic-services{padding:0 15px;display:unset;float:left;width:100%}
.octa-processnig &gt; .row &gt; div{margin:0 0 40px}
.octa-processnig &gt; .row &gt; div:last-child{margin:0}
.octa-process .row &gt; div{width:50%}
.video-inner{position:relative;float:left;width:100%;background:#2e2e2e;padding:40px}
.video-text{padding:40px 0 0;text-align:center}
.video-text h3{padding:0 0 30px;margin:0 0 30px}
.fancy-team &gt; .row &gt; div{float:left;width:50%}
.logos-carousel-wrap{margin:0;padding:40px}
.octa-fullpage-title{margin-left:40px}
.octa-fullpage-title h3{font-size:32px;margin:0 0 20px}
.huge-text h1{font-size:50px}
.huge-text i{font-size:200px}
.huge-text{margin:0}
.modern-featured img{width:100%;margin:0}
.modern-featured{margin:0;padding:0 15px}
.mod-feat-text{width:100%;margin:50px 0 0;text-align:center;padding:0} 
.mod-feat-text h1{font-size:40px} 
.special-name{position:relative;float:left;width:94%;transform:none;left:3%;top:-25px}
.octa-gallery .row &gt; div{float:left;width:16.668%}
.portfolio-text .row &gt; div{float:left;width:100%;margin:0 0 50px}
.portfolio-text .row &gt; div:last-child{margin:0}
.portfolio-detail-top{padding:100px 0}
.portfolio-detail-top h1{font-size:50px}
.portfolio-detail.style2 .info-box{width:100%}
.portfolio-detail.style2{padding:0 15px}
.portfolio-detail.style2 &gt; .row &gt; div{float:left;width:100%;margin:0 0 50px}
.portfolio-detail.style2 &gt; .row &gt; div:last-child{margin:0}
.team-detail{display:unset}
.abt-img{display:unset;float:left;width:100%}
.abt-img img{width:100%} 
.team-detail-text{display:unset;float:left;width:100%;padding:40px 0 0}
.team-detail .octa-skills{width:100%}
.team-detail .round-socials{float:left;width:100%;margin:30px 0 0}
.team-detail-text &gt; h1{font-size:40px} 
.team-detail-text &gt; span{font-size:20px}

.main-desc{margin:0}
.map.full{position:relative;float:left;width:100%;margin:0}
.dark-contact-box{margin:0}
.align-self-end .fancy-socials{margin:0 0 20px}
.lang-desktop {display: none;}
.lang-mobile {left: 40px;right: auto;}
}


@media (max-width:767px){
header.hdr-border, header{padding:15px 0}
.container, .block .container{max-width:none;width:100%;padding:0 15px}
.big-title{font-size:100px}
.simple-portfolio.no-gap{padding:0 15px}
.full-height{height:auto!important}
.form-btn{right:10px;bottom:10px}
.creative-featured h2{font-size:55px}
.creative-featured i{font-size:25px}
.simple-parallax &gt; h4{font-size:35px;line-height:1.2}
.simple-parallax &gt; p{font-size:22px}
.table-container{display:unset;float:left;width:100%}
.table-container{display:unset}
.octa-welcome{padding:0}
.fullpage-header{width:50px}
.fullmenu-btn{width:50px;font-size:28px;height:50px;line-height:50px}
.blackbar .octa-name{padding:20px 15px 20px 45px;width:260px}
body.menu-opened .fullpage-header .sideheader{left:50px;width:230px}
.split-project{display:unset;float:left;overflow:auto}
.split-img{display:unset;float:left;height:400px;width:100%}
.split-text{display:unset;float:left;width:100%;padding:140px 20px}
.split-text h3{font-size:40px}
.split-quote p{font-size:30px}
.split-text h4{font-size:40px}
.decent-img:hover .decent-hover{transform:translateX(-15px)}
.error-page h1{font-size:160px;margin:0 0 40px}
.error-page span{font-size:20px;padding:5px 20px;margin:0 0 30px}
.error-page p{font-size:18px}
.pagetop h1{font-size:43px}
.pagetop{padding:170px 0 70px}
.octa-author{display:unset}
.octa-author &gt; img{display:unset}
.author-inner{display:unset;padding:30px 0 0;float:left;width:100%}
.octa-author .round-socials{float:left;width:100%;margin:0 0 20px} 
.comment{display:unset;float:left;width:100%}
.comment &gt; img{display:unset}
.comment-inner{display:unset;padding:30px 0 0;float:left;width:100%}
.octa-comments li ul{padding:0} 
.post-title{font-size:24px}
.octa-blog-detail .cat-box{padding:5px 15px}
.octa-blog-detail .cat-box a{font-size:12px}
.subscribe-form button{position:relative;float:left;width:100%;right:0;top:0}
.subscribe-form{height:auto;background:none;border:0}
.subscribe-form input{background:#FFF;height:60px;border-radius:50px;width:100%;padding:0 30px;margin:0 0 10px}
.portfolio-single-img.stretch{margin:0 0 30px;width:100%}
.portfolio-title{font-size:34px}
h2.portfolio-title{font-size:23px}
.project-video a.zoomer img{width:70px}
.abt-img img{transform:none}
.simple-featured{margin:150px 0 100px}
.simple-featured h2{font-size:50px}


.action-text{max-width:none;width:100%}
.call-action .octa-btn{float:left;margin-top:30px}
}

@media (max-width:480px){
.simple-featured h2{font-size:45px}
.col-title{font-size:35px}
.simple-services{padding:30px 30px 20px}
.big-title{font-size:50px;margin:0 0 -4px}
.masonary &gt; div{width:100%}
.simple-hover{padding:30px}
.octa-counters .row &gt; div{width:100%}
.octa-title h2{font-size:42px}
.octa-team .row &gt; div{width:100%}
.octa-post.style2 .date{position:relative;float:left;width:100%;left:0;top:0;right:auto;width:100%;margin:0 0 30px}
.octa-post.style2 .post-name{padding:30px}
.octa-contacts-opts .row &gt; div{margin:0;width:100%}
.bottombar p{width:100%;text-align:center;margin:0 0 25px}
.bottombar .socials{width:100%;text-align:center}
.bottombar .socials a{float:none;display:inline-block;margin:0 4px}
.sideheader{width:80%;right:-80%}
.sidemenu ul{padding:0 30px}
.action-text{width:100%;max-width:none;margin:0 0 30px}
footer .container &gt; .row &gt; div{max-width:100%}
.innovative-featured h3{font-size:45px}
.innovative-img img{margin:0;width:100%}
.octa-process .row &gt; div{width:100%}
.fancy-team &gt; .row &gt; div{width:100%}
.octa-fullpage-title{padding:40px 20px}
.octa-fullpage-title h3{font-size:25px}
.octa-fullpage-title .octa-btn{padding:10px 30px;font-size:13px}
.contact-form-inner{width:100%;padding:0 20px;max-height:100%;overflow:auto}
.big-intro{font-size:35px}
.huge-text h1{font-size:30px}
.huge-text i{font-size:90px}
.mod-feat-text h1{font-size:30px}
.octa-gallery .row &gt; div{width:33.334%}
.post-information .round-socials{float:left;width:100%;margin-top:20px}
.find-box p{float:left;width:100%;margin:20px 0 0}
.portfolio-pagination{padding:30px 10px}
.portfolio-pagination a{font-size:24px}
.portfolio-pagination a.prev, .portfolio-pagination a.next{font-size:14px}
.portfolio-pagination a.prev i,.portfolio-pagination a.next i{font-size:20px}
.project-info li{width:100%}
.bottombar .logo{width:100%;text-align:center;margin:0 0 20px}


.innovative-intro h1{font-size:30px}
.innovative-intro h1 strong{font-size:30px}
.stylish-portfolio{width:100%!important}
}

</pre></body></html>